What is a Drainage Cell?
A drainage cell is a modular system made of high-density polyethylene (HDPE) or other durable materials. These cells are designed to create an efficient and durable drainage system by providing a channel for water to flow through. The interlocking design allows for easy installation, and the structure of the drainage cell ensures that water is effectively drained while also preventing soil compaction and erosion.
The drainage cells are usually installed under various surfaces, such as green roofs, driveways, roads, and other areas that require effective water management. They serve to enhance the performance of the drainage system by creating voids that allow water to flow through easily, preventing pooling and reducing the risk of flooding.
How Does a Drainage Cell Work?
Drainage cells are designed to support and manage water flow in an efficient and systematic manner. When installed, they provide a void space where water can accumulate and be stored temporarily, allowing the drainage system to handle water runoff more effectively. Here’s how they work:
-
Water Storage: The cells are designed to capture and hold rainwater or excess water from irrigation. They store water in their cavities, allowing it to drain away gradually. This helps in reducing the pressure on the drainage system and prevents waterlogging.
-
Effective Drainage: The perforated nature of drainage cells allows water to flow through the system without causing blockages. The cells ensure water is directed away from the surface, preventing water damage and reducing the chances of erosion.
-
Soil Preservation: Since the drainage cells prevent water from pooling on the surface, they help protect the soil structure from being washed away. In applications such as green roofs, drainage cells help maintain the integrity of the soil layer, which is essential for plant growth.
-
Flood Prevention: By efficiently managing water flow, drainage cells reduce the risk of flooding, especially in areas with high rainfall or where water management is a challenge.
Types of Drainage Cells
There are different types of drainage cells available, each with unique properties and benefits suited to specific applications. Some of the commonly used types include:
-
Green Roof Drainage Cells: These are specifically designed for use in green roofing systems, where plants are cultivated. The cells provide excellent drainage and water retention, promoting healthy plant growth.
-
Landscaping Drainage Cells: Used in landscaping projects to prevent water pooling and manage runoff, these drainage cells help maintain the aesthetic and functional integrity of outdoor spaces.
-
Subsurface Drainage Cells: These cells are used under hard surfaces, such as pavements and roads, to allow for the quick and efficient flow of water without causing damage to the surface.
-
Flood Control Drainage Cells: These drainage cells are specially designed to handle excess stormwater and prevent flooding in areas prone to heavy rainfall.
Benefits of Drainage Cells
-
Efficient Water Management: Drainage cells help to quickly and effectively manage large volumes of water. By providing storage space and a clear path for water to drain, they reduce the chances of waterlogging and ensure that drainage systems perform optimally.
-
Reduced Erosion: The cells help to stabilize the ground, preventing soil erosion in areas where water runoff could otherwise wash away valuable topsoil.
-
Long-Term Durability: Drainage cells are designed to last for many years, with their strong and robust construction ensuring that they can withstand heavy loads and harsh environmental conditions.
-
Sustainability: Drainage cells are often made from recyclable materials such as HDPE, contributing to more sustainable construction practices. They also help in water conservation by facilitating the collection and storage of rainwater for later use.
-
Cost-Effective: Since drainage cells are modular and easy to install, they can save costs on labor and material compared to traditional drainage systems. Their ability to reduce the need for maintenance and repair also contributes to cost savings over the long term.

Applications of Drainage Cells
-
Green Roofs: Drainage cells are an integral part of green roof systems. They provide the necessary support for the plants while ensuring proper water drainage. The cells store water for irrigation while also preventing soil erosion.
-
Roads and Pavements: Drainage cells are used under roads, pavements, and driveways to manage water runoff effectively. They help prevent waterlogging and surface damage by ensuring water is quickly drained.
-
Landscaping: In landscaping projects, drainage cells help maintain the health of plants by providing effective water management. They are particularly useful in areas with heavy rainfall.
-
Sports Fields and Parks: Drainage cells are widely used in sports fields and parks to ensure the grounds remain dry and usable after heavy rains.
